Women's Track, Swimming Take ACC Titles
By Staff Editor | Feb. 19, 2001BLACKSBURG, Va. -- The North Carolina women's track team won its ninth consecutive ACC Indoor Championship on Saturday at Virginia Tech, marking UNC's 13th title in 15 years, all under the direction of coach Dennis Craddock. The women finished with 144 points, followed by Clemson with 98 and Georgia Tech with 83.50. UNC's men's team finished second with 93 points behind Clemson's 181 points. Florida State rounded out the top three with 86 points. The women, led by several freshmen, produced outstanding performances during the final day of the championships.
